Volkswagen Passat is a sophisticated and versatile car that provides performance as well as comfort and design. It's a great choice for a car that can be used as a family vehicle. Like many vehicles, it requires a special key to work. Obtaining a replacement isn't easy and can be expensive.

young-couple-holding-the-keys-of-a-new-car-select-2023-04-03-23-35-08-utc-scaled.jpgThe cost of the cost of a VW Passat key replacement is affected by several factors. These include the type of key you need, where you buy it, and how much programming is required.

Key Cost

The price of a Volkswagen key varies based on the type of key you need. Keys made of metal are the cheapest, keys with remote locking systems or chip technology are more expensive. The type of car you own can also affect the price of keys. Generally speaking, new volkswagen key cutting service near me keys are available from auto locksmiths, car dealerships, hardware stores and even online retailers. Typically, buying keys from the dealership is more expensive than buying one from an independent source.

In addition to traditional metal components, modern VW keys contain a transponder chip which communicates with your car's immobilizer system. When you insert your key into the ignition, it energizes the readout coil, which then transmits an individual code to the evaluation unit. The evaluation unit determines if the ignition key is allowed to start. If the code isn't valid the vehicle will not start and will shut down immediately. This feature is designed to prevent hot-wiring. Hot-wiring occurs when someone inserts an unauthorised key into the ignition and the vehicle starts.

Cost of Programming Keys

The cost of programming the key is contingent on the year of your vehicle, make and models. It can range from $50 for a standard key to more than $500 for a smart key that has push-to-start technology. These keys must be paired with your car by an auto locksmith or dealer, which increases the overall cost of replacement. No matter what kind of key you choose having a spare key is always an ideal option.

You can purchase spare keys from a variety of sources, including dealerships, online retailers, automotive locksmiths, and hardware stores. The majority of these outlets have the technology to duplicate traditional car keys but they will not be capable of programming transponder chips or smart keys. A dealership for cars is usually the most expensive option however, it could be worth the extra money if you want a genuine OEM key.

Key duplication for cars typically start at around $25, and this fee will include a cut key and key-cutting costs. If you opt for a laser-cut key, the price will be slightly higher as the cutting machine needs more time and precision to make this kind of key. Similarly, the cost of replacing a smart key could be quite costly as the fobs are equipped with advanced features such as proximity detection, which requires special programming.

If you are unable to find an ignition key for your Volkswagen car, it is likely that the fob will need to be programmed to function with the vehicle. This is typically done by a dealership or an independent locksmith, and the cost for programming will be based on the specific make and model of your vehicle.

You can save money by purchasing a key blank from a hardware store and then having it reprogrammed by the local locksmith shop or VW dealership. You could also try resyncing your key fob with the emergency key function on the key. It's a straightforward procedure, but you will need to have a spare key in order to use it. Cost of Transponder Keys

Modern car keys are equipped with a transponder chip which communicates with the computer onboard of the vehicle. This technology helps prevent theft by ensuring that only the right key can be used to start the engine. This also ensures that the vehicle isn't harmed when it is unlocked or locked. However, these features could be costly. The price of a transponder will differ based on the year, make and model of your vehicle, along with any additional features.

You will need to pay additional fees for programming, in addition to the replacement key. This is a different procedure from traditional key duplication and requires a machine to extract the immobilizer codes from the vehicle's computers. The price of this service can vary widely, but will often run up to $150.

The location of your house will also impact the cost of a transponder. In cities in which there are numerous locksmiths and auto dealerships the cost of a replacement key could be more expensive. Additionally, if you require your key to be programmed by a dealer, the price can be even more expensive.

You can be sure that when you own a volkswagen key cutting model that was manufactured in the past decade, it is equipped with transponders. This means you can purchase an additional key from a dealer or an independent auto locksmith. The dealer will have to program the key in order that it works correctly, and this could increase the cost of the key.

Modern car keys need to be programmed in order to match the vehicle computer system. This makes them more costly to produce and may be a deterrent to thieves.

You can purchase a transponder key from a variety of sources, including auto locksmiths, car dealerships, online retailers, and hardware stores. You can also purchase a transponder key that is blank from an online retailer and then cut it locally. It is important to remember that the price of a blank transponder key is significantly less than the cost of a complete key with an embedded chip and fob.

Cost of a Smart Key

A smart key is a car key equipped with a remote keyless entry technology. They tend to be more expensive than traditional keys due to the fact that they require more sophisticated circuitry to operate. However, they provide greater security since they send a unique code to your vehicle that is not accessible to devices that are not authorized. This means that only your vehicle can utilize this feature, which prevents thieves from hotwiring the stolen vehicle to start it.

To replace the Volkswagen smart key, you must visit the dealer and provide some documents. You will need a copy your driver's license, vehicle identification number (VIN) and your registration. The dealership will then order an additional key from Volkswagen. The new volkswagen key (visit my web page) key typically takes two to five days to arrive. When the new key is delivered, your dealer will program it to your vehicle.

You can purchase a replacement metal VW key, but without the remote, for less than $100. The dealer will cut keys for you based on your VIN. Then, you can use it to lock or unlock the doors and trunk. It won't be able to start the engine, but it is an excellent idea to have an additional key in case you lose yours.

Key fobs are a different kind of key with built-in remote keys that are not required. They can be used to unlock and lock your vehicle. Some even have features such as starting the engine at the touch of a single button. You can purchase a key fob at your local dealership or from an automotive locksmith. They are more expensive than a key made of metal.

The cost of a key fob can vary depending on your location as well as the make and model of your vehicle. A basic transponder key is about $50, while an intelligent key with remote locking systems can cost more than $500. In addition to the initial cost of keys, you'll be charged for programming and other services.
